Court chairman: Amnesty was amateurish
Prague, Jan 10 (CTK) - The preparation of Czech President Vaclav Klaus's New Year amnesty was amateurish, chairman of the Constitutional Court (US) Pavel Rychetsky said in an interview with the financial paper Hospodarske noviny (HN) Thursday.
Prime Minister Petr Necas (Civic Democratic Party, ODS) ought to have found out the impact of the amnesty, Rychetsky said.
The president himself cannot take such a serious step, he added.
"We are witnesses to an incredible amateurish approach. Since 1920, all amnesties were prepared by the government, primarily by the justice minister, not by the Presidential Office," Rychetsky told the paper.
The prime minister's duty to countersign the amnesty is embedded in the constitution because the government should not only prepare the amnesty, but also evaluate its impact, Rychetsky said.
Klaus declared an extensive amnesty on the 20th anniversary of the Czech Republic in his New Year's speech. About 6300 people have been released from prison as yet.
The amnesty pardons some prisoners as well as people given suspended sentences and halts criminal prosecution that continued for at least eight years and the punishment does not carry more than ten years.
The scope of the amnesty has caused a public ouctry.
Critics say it will also cover some corruption and fraud cases.
"It is within the power of neither the president nor the prime minster to evaluate this. This must be done by an army of Justice Ministry officials," he added.
The government ought to have at first found out who will be pardoned by the amnesty, Rychetsky said.
Necas said on Wednesday the granting of an amnesty is a sovereign right of the president and the prime minister only confirms with his signature in consistence with constitutional habits that it is not at variance with the legal order.
In an emotional speech on Tuesday, Klaus said the criticism of the amnesty was an attack against him and the ideas he advocated.
